Campbellsville Regulations

STRs are explicitly allowed citywide with no visible caps or zoning restrictions, and no business license or inspection is mentioned. However, operators must collect and remit a 3% transient tax and file a monthly tax return, creating moderate reporting/compliance effort that keeps the environment friendly but not very simple.

About Campbellsville

Campbellsville is a small city in central Kentucky that serves as the county seat of Taylor County. With a population of roughly eleven to twelve thousand residents, it carries the easygoing rhythm of a classic Bluegrass college town, anchored by the presence of Campbellsville University. The community is best known as a convenient gateway to outdoor recreation on nearby Green River Lake and as a quiet stop along the corridor between Louisville, about ninety miles to the north, and Lexington, roughly eighty miles to the northeast. Travelers passing through often use Campbellsville as a base for exploring the rolling farmland, wooded ridges, and reservoirs of the central Kentucky countryside.

Just a short drive southeast of town, Green River Lake State Park is the area's marquee draw. The park wraps around an eight-thousand-acre reservoir and offers a full menu of lake activities, including boating, fishing, swimming at the beach, and paddling along the Green River. It also features a marina, campground, and miles of shoreline trails, making it a year-round destination for families and anglers. Most of the park's main access points sit within about fifteen to twenty minutes of downtown Campbellsville.

Within the city itself, the campus of Campbellsville University gives the town a collegiate energy and provides a steady stream of visitors for sporting events, performances, and conferences throughout the year. Founded in 1906, the private Baptist-affiliated university is one of the larger employers in the county and contributes to the welcoming, community-oriented feel of the downtown area. Strolling the historic square, with its locally owned shops, diners, and a renovated theater, offers a sense of small-town Kentucky life that has largely resisted the homogenization seen in larger cities.

A few miles west of Campbellsville lies the Tebbs Bend area, where a Civil War engagement in July 1863 is commemorated along the Green River. Interpretive markers and a small bridge crossing recall the Union stand against Confederate forces, and the surrounding landscape offers a quiet place for history-minded visitors to stretch their legs. The battlefield ties Campbellsville into a broader circuit of central Kentucky Civil War sites that enthusiasts often string together in a single trip.

For short-term rental owners, Campbellsville offers a compelling mix of small-town charm, collegiate foot traffic, and proximity to a major state park. Its location within easy driving distance of both Louisville and Lexington broadens the potential guest pool, while the lake draws returning families, fishermen, and outdoor recreationists throughout the warmer months. Combined with affordable property values and a friendly, community-minded atmosphere, the city makes for an approachable entry point into Kentucky's short-term rental market.
